Vetri Speciali To Absorb Three Units

Italian glass wholesaler Vetri Speciali S.p.A., which is 43.5% owned by Italian textile, wine and glass group Industrie Zignago Santa Margherita S.p.A., signed a deal on 30 May 2005 to incorporate its wholly-owned special glass making units Nord Vetri S.p.A., Vetrerie Venete S.p.A. and Attivita Industriali Friuli S.r.l, all located in north-eastern Italy. The three companies registered a combined turnover of some EUR 82 million (USD 101.7 million) in 2003.
